Outage Management System Industry Product Innovations
Recent product innovations focus on integrating advanced analytics, AI, and machine learning to enhance outage prediction, diagnosis, and restoration. The use of IoT sensors and drones for real-time data collection is revolutionizing outage management. These innovations offer competitive advantages by enabling proactive outage management, minimizing downtime, and optimizing resource allocation. The market is witnessing a shift towards cloud-based OMS solutions offering scalability, cost-effectiveness, and enhanced data accessibility. This fosters collaboration and improved decision-making across different utility teams.

Key Drivers of Outage Management System Industry Growth
Several factors are driving the growth of the OMS industry. The increasing frequency and severity of power outages due to extreme weather events and aging infrastructure are primary drivers. Government regulations and incentives promoting grid modernization and renewable energy integration are pushing the adoption of OMS. Technological advancements, such as the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), and machine learning, are enhancing the capabilities and efficiency of OMS solutions. Furthermore, the growing need for real-time data analytics and improved grid visibility are propelling market growth.
Challenges in the Outage Management System Industry Sector
The OMS industry faces certain challenges. High initial investment costs associated with implementing OMS can deter smaller utilities, especially in developing countries. The integration of various systems within the utility grid can be complex and time-consuming. Cybersecurity threats pose a significant challenge, as OMS systems handle sensitive grid data. Lastly, the lack of skilled personnel to operate and maintain sophisticated OMS systems can hinder widespread adoption.
